Explore the historic Penycloddiau Hill Fort and its surroundings on this easy out-and-back hiking route in St Asaph. The trail is approximately 2.7 kilometers long with an elevation gain of 112 meters, making it a perfect choice for hikers of all levels.

Starting at the designated parking area, you will pass by a natural water source at around 1.35 kilometers into the hike. Be sure to refill your water bottles here if needed. As you continue on the trail, you'll come across a rocky area at the same distance, adding a bit of terrain variation to the hike.

One of the highlights of the route is the archaeological site located midway through the hike. Take some time to explore and learn about the history of the area before heading back towards the starting point.

Although this hike is relatively easy, it's always advisable to bring water, snacks, and to check the weather forecast before setting out.
